Shelving unit with capacity increasing tie members

A tie bar for connecting two horizontal beams includes first and second elongate walls arranged parallel to each other, and a third elongate wall arranged perpendicular to the first and second elongate walls and coupled to a lateral side of each of the first and second elongate walls. The tie bar further includes at least one pair of hook elements positioned at terminal ends of at least one of the first, second, or third elongate walls. Each of the hook elements includes a depending tab configured to be received by an elongate slot of a horizontal beam of a shelving unit. The first and second elongate walls may be top and bottom walls, respectively, the third elongate wall may be a side wall, and the at least one pair of hook elements may include first and second hook elements positioned on the second elongate wall.

Slide Rail Assembly and Slide Rail Mechanism Thereof

A slide rail mechanism includes a slide rail and a reinforcing structure. The slide rail includes a first section and a second section. The second section is bent relative to the first section. The reinforcing structure is arranged at the slide rail. The reinforcing structure includes a first part and a second part. The second part is bent relative to the first part. Wherein, the first part and the second part are respectively attached to the first section and the second section.

Wall hanger

A wall hanger includes a vertical column including a front wall, a first sidewall having a plurality of first coupling holes, and a second sidewall having a plurality of second sidewalls. A connecting member includes a front board and a sideboard. At least one first coupling member is disposed on the sideboard and is coupled with one of the plurality of first coupling holes. At least one second coupling member extends from a side of the front board. A bracket is disposed in front of the vertical column and includes an arm. The arm includes a rear end having at least one third coupling member selectively engaged with at least one of the plurality of second coupling holes of the second sidewall. The rear end of the arm further includes at least one third coupling hole engaged with the at least one second coupling member.

SLIDE RAIL MECHANISM AND BRACKET DEVICE THEREOF

A slide rail mechanism includes a rail member, a supporting frame and a bracket. The supporting frame is movable relative to the rail member and the bracket. The bracket includes a side wall and at least one mounting member adjacent to the side wall. The at least one mounting member configured to pass through a mounting hole of a post. When the supporting frame is moved relative to the bracket from a first position to a second position, the supporting frame is configured to drive the at least one mounting member to move relative to the side wall.

BRACKET DEVICE

A bracket device includes a sidewall, at least one mounting member, an elastic member, and a fastening member is adjacent to the sidewall. The at least one mounting member is connected to the base. The fastening member is movably mounted on the sidewall, includes an engaging structure, can stay in a first state responsive to the elastic force provided by the elastic member, and can be switched from the first state to a second state by operation. The engaging structure of the fastening member is configured to engage with or be mounted to a target member.

Bracket device

A bracket device includes a bracket, at least one mounting member, and a hook. The bracket has an end plate. The at least one mounting member is mounted on the end plate of the bracket. The hook is movably connected to the bracket in order to be at either one of a first position and a second position with respect to the bracket. The hook is extended with respect to the end plate of the bracket when at the first position and is retracted with respect to the end plate of the bracket when at the second position.
